Mike Peterson, or also better known as Deathlok, is a recurring character in the ABC TV series Marvel’s Agents of S.H.I.E.L.D., first appearing as a supporting anti-villain in Season 1, while later appearing as a supporting protagonist in the second half of Season 2 and the 100th episode of Season 5.

What happened to Deathlok in the comics?

Remaining stuporous, Deathlok was taken into S.H.I.E.L.D. custody and later stolen by agents of Roxxon. Deathlok was studied by Earth-616’s Harlan Ryker at Roxxon’s Brand Corporation subdivision, who designed a robotic Deathlok which was destroyed by the Thing and Quasar while invading Project: PEGASUS.

When was the first issue of Daredevil published?

The first issue of Daredevil (April 1964) features the hero in his original costume. Splash-page art by Jack Kirby (penciler) and Bill Everett (inker). Daredevil (Matt Murdock) is a fictional superhero app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ics.
